Los jornales de dos obreros suman S/.60. Si uno de ellos gana S/.12
más que el otro. ¿Cuánto ganan cada uno de ellos?
Answer:
Cada uno de ellos gana:
S/. 24
S/. 36
Step-by-step explanation:
Planteamiento:
a + b = 60
a = 12 + b
Desarrollo:
sustituyendo el valor de la segunda ecuación del planteamiento en la primer ecuación del planteamiento:
(12+b) + b = 60
2b + 12 = 60
2b = 60 - 12
2b = 48
b = 48/2
b = 24
de la segunda ecuación del planteamiento:
a = 12 + b
a = 12 + 24
a = 36
Check:
24 + 36 = 60

Brian needs $315 to buy a new cell phone. He has already saved $115 and plans to save an additional
$10 per week. He also needs to pay off the balance on his current phone, which is $140. How many
weeks will he have to save to buy the phone?
Answer:
34 weeks
Step-by-step explanation:
Hello!
We can set up an equation to solve for the number of weeks.
Let w = the number of weeks he is saving up.
The equation is \(315 = 115 + 10w - 140\)
315 is the target amount115 is the current amount10w is the rate of growth140 is the current debtSolve for w\(315 = 115 + 10w - 140\)\(315 = -25 + 10w\)\(340 = 10w\)\(340/10 = w\)\(34 = w\)He needs to save up for 34 weeks.

A and B are points on a circle, centre O
DBC is the tangent to the circle at B
angle AOB=x
show that ABC = 1/2 x
give reasons for each stage in your workings.
Angle ABC is equal to 1/2 x, proved as required.
What is the proof for ABC = 1/2x?To prove that ABC = 1/2 x, we will use the following reasoning:
The line from A to O and another line from B to O, are two radii of the circle.Since OA and OB are radii of the circle, they have the same length, denoted by r.Angle AOB is given to be x⁰.Angle OBA is equal to angle OAB, as they are opposite angles in an isosceles triangle.∴ ∠ OAB = ∠OBA = (180 - x)/2 (the sum of angles in a triangle is 180 degrees and ∠ AOB is twice the size of ∠ OAB)
∠ABC = ∠OBC - ∠OBA. (the sum of angles in a triangle is 180 degrees).
∠OBC is a right angle, since it is the angle between a radius and a tangent to the circle at B.
∴, ∠OBC = 90 ⁰
Substituting in the values we have found, we get:
ABC = OBC - OBA
ABC = 90 - (180 - x)/2 = x/2.
Therefore, ABC = 1/2 x, as required.

The formula for centripetal acceleration, a, is given by this formula, where v is the velocity of the object and r is the object’s distance from the center of the circular path: a=v^2/r . Solve the formula for r.
Answer:
r = V^2/a
Step-by-step explanation:
Here, we want to write the formula for r
What this simply mean is that we want to make r the formula subject
We have this as follows;
a = V^2/r
r = V^2/a
